Participants will receive an introduction to baking with gluten-free flours and learn about the qualities that individual flours contribute to a blend. They will sample a few of the chef’s favorite gluten-free recipes and receive tips for using both gluten-free and non-gluten-free flour recipes. At the end of the class, attendees will roll up their sleeves and create their own gluten-free flour blend to take home. It is recommended that anyone with their own digital scale bring it to class. This session is ideal for beginner to intermediate bakers.

Chef Chance Claar-Pressley
Chef Chance has been teaching small classes in the Edible Garden Outdoor Kitchen at the Atlanta Botanical Garden since 2013, covering topics such as homemade pie making, canning, jam-making, cooking with herbs, aquafaba, and many more. Her approachable recipes and style emphasize seasonal ingredients and focus on demystifying popular ingredients for use in everyday cooking.
